Healthy and Delicious Vegan Food
Eating vegan can be a great way to start a healthy lifestyle. The vegan diet consists of plant-based foods that are naturally cholesterol-free and low in saturated fat. Eating vegan meals is linked to a reduced risk of heart disease, diabetes, and some forms of cancer. Plus, it's environmentally friendly! With so many benefits, it can be hard to know where to start. Fortunately, it's easy to make delicious and affordable vegan meals.
Vegan Staples
The foundation of vegan cooking is plant-based staples. Beans, lentils, and quinoa are all packed with protein, fiber, and essential vitamins and minerals. These ingredients can be used to make a variety of dishes, from tacos to salads to curries. Whole grains, like brown rice and barley, are also excellent sources of nutrition, and can be cooked in a variety of ways. Fruits and vegetables are essential to any vegan diet, so be sure to include plenty of them in your meals.
Simple and Inexpensive Recipes
If you're looking for easy vegan recipes, you don't have to look far. There are plenty of delicious and affordable vegan meals that require minimal effort to make. For example, a simple quinoa bowl with roasted vegetables, avocado, and a drizzle of olive oil is a great option. Or, you could make a vegan lentil soup or curry. You can also whip up some vegan pancakes or muffins in a flash.
Healthy Snacks
Vegan snacks are a great way to keep your energy levels up throughout the day. There are plenty of healthy vegan snacks that can be made quickly and cheaply. For example, you can make your own hummus with chickpeas and tahini, or spread some almond butter on whole grain toast. Other great options include roasted chickpeas, trail mix, and fruit and nut bars.
Plant-Based Protein Sources
If you're looking for vegan protein sources, look no further. There are plenty of plant-based proteins that can be added to your meals. Tofu, tempeh, and seitan are all great sources of vegan protein. Nuts, seeds, and legumes are also great options. You can add these ingredients to salads, soups, stews, and stir-fries.
Eating Vegan on a Budget
Eating vegan doesn't have to be expensive. In fact, it can be quite affordable if you plan ahead. Frozen fruits and vegetables are usually much cheaper than fresh, and you can buy them in bulk to save money. Bulk bins are also a great way to buy legumes, grains, and nuts at a lower cost. If you plan your meals ahead of time and stick to a budget, you can eat vegan without breaking the bank.
